Project Type Typical Range
Walk-in Shower Installation $1,200 - $2,800
Shower Conversion (Bathtub to Shower) $2,500 - $5,500
Full Bathroom Remodel $4,000 - $8,000
Accessibility Shower Installation $3,000 - $6,500
Shower Door Replacement $500 - $1,500
Shower Fixture Upgrade $300 - $900

Installing an elderly shower in Larimer County, CO, involves selecting appropriate materials and ensuring the setup meets accessibility needs.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and budgeting for this upgrade.

  • Materials commonly include low-threshold or curbless shower bases, slip-resistant tiles, and grab bars for safety and accessibility.
  • The scope of installation varies based on shower size and additional features, such as seating or hand-held shower heads.
  • Labor complexity depends on existing plumbing configurations and the extent of modifications needed for accessibility compliance.
  • Permitting requirements may apply depending on local building codes and the scope of the renovation.
  • Optional extras can include waterproof wall panels, built-in seating, and enhanced grab bar systems for added convenience.

Scope/Size Typical Range
Standard Walk-In Shower $3,000 - $7,000
Wheelchair-Accessible Shower $5,000 - $12,000
Shower with Grab Bars and Seating $4,000 - $9,000
Complete Bathroom Renovation including Shower $10,000 - $25,000
